    Abstract: Systems, methods, and devices are provided for estimating when preventive maintenance of power capacitors is called for. Such a system may include, for example, a voltage sensor, a current sensor, and data processing circuitry. The voltage sensor may measure a voltage difference across a phase of a power capacitor. The current sensor may measure a current across the phase of the power capacitor. The data processing circuitry to determine a first instantaneous indication of a difference between a nominal capacitance of the power capacitor and an actual value of the power capacitor based at least in part on the measured first voltage difference and first current.
